No the issue is the OP is double NATed. Comcast only issues internet gateways (Modem/Router) and the OP is using a 3rd party router. So while the OP is port forwarded, the OP still has a second layer of NAT to worry about due to the Comcast gateway. When the OP buys a standard cable modem, the issue should be resolved.
